Tuition by Program

This school charges tuition on a per-program basis. Costs vary depending on the program of study.

Barbering/Barber

11 months

$19,995
Welding Technology/Welder

8 months

$12,250

Moore Career College in LA offers 2 programs with tuition ranging from $12,250 to $19,995. Financial aid brings the average net price to $18,098.

Student Loans (2022-23)

Most students at Moore Career College borrow: 100% take out federal student loans, averaging $7,508 per borrower. Planning for repayment should start early.

Total Borrowers

80

100% of students

Average Loan Amount

$7,508
